Abstract

The aim of writing this article is to analyze the Sunni-Syi’ah conflict after the Arab Spring. The method used in writing this article is a qualitative method with technical data collection using literature studies. Sunni and Syi’ah groups are the largest Islamic groups in the world which often experience differences and contradictions regarding their views. them in Islamic teachings, especially in theological and political views. Sunni-Syi’ah conflicts have occurred even since after the Prophet sallallaahu alaihi wa sallam until now. This conflict has had a big influence on political turmoil in the Middle East, especially after the Arab Spring. Various conflicts in various Middle Eastern countries such as Iraq, Iran, Saudi Arabia, Lebanon, Syria, Yemen, and others are not apart from the issue of the Sunni- Syi’ah conflict. Even though the Sunni-Syi’ah conflict is not the main factor in the occurrence of various political upheavals in the Middle East, the issue of this conflict is always an accompaniment to every political upheaval in the Middle East
